Burnley manager Vincent Kompany is preparing for their next Premier League match against Brighton at Turf Moor. In his pre-match news conference, Kompany described Brighton as a “unique opposition” after their previous encounter at Amex Stadium in December ended in a draw.

Brighton has been able to establish themselves in the league with the habits of the top teams despite not being classified as one of the big six teams. Kompany praised their ability to demand that even bigger teams adapt their game when facing them. This makes them exceptional in the league.

Kompany highlighted Brighton’s style of play, mentioning how they force their opponents to adapt by finding positions in between the lines and creating overloads to find the free man. Whether facing a zonal press or a man-orientated press, Brighton have movement patterns that allow them to create space and exploit the opposition’s weaknesses.

The Burnley manager acknowledged Brighton’s control of the tempo, their goalkeeper’s role as an outfield player, and their quick recovery of the ball when possession is lost. This style of play has been developed over years, showcasing Brighton’s dedication to their strategic approach to the game.

Ultimately, Kompany recognizes Brighton’s success as not something that happened overnight but rather as a result of years of dedication to their tactical approach. The upcoming match against Brighton promises to be a challenging one for Burnley, given the unique playing style of their opponents.
